SUMMARY Running kde neon plasma CE on a hp g4 405 mini pc with amd ryzen and Vega graphics. When I open system monitor gpu is always 100%, despite cpu being less than 10% utilization. I checked with a different program and actual gpu usage is closer to 10-15%. Idk what is going on as All other parts of system monitor are working. STEPS TO REPRODUCE 1.
